South Suburban College to Continue On-Campus COVID-19 Testing through SHIELD Illinois in 2023 (South Holland, IL) — South Suburban College (SSC) will continue to provide COVID-19 testing services in South Holland through SHIELD Illinois in 2023. A fourth day has been added to the testing schedule when the college reopens from the holiday closure on Tuesday, January 3, 2023. Testing services will be offered Mondays and Thursdays from 2 – 4 p.m., Tuesdays from 4 – 6 p.m., and Fridays from 9 a.m. – 12 p.m.

SHIELD provides results quickly and is accessible in the Mi-Jack Room on the first floor of the college’s Main Campus at 15800 South State Street, South Holland, Illinois. While no appointment is necessary, patients must create an account on Portal.shieldillinois.com using agency code df5brbrj to receive test results. Individuals who need a test may show up during testing hours or preschedule an appointment during the aforesaid timeframes. This service is available to SSC students, administrators, faculty, staff, and the community at large.
